This rusty, crusty old mid-1940s Dodge one-ton pickup truck has a new purpose in life. It serves as a charming piece of vintage yard-art for tourists traveling by train between Skagway, Alaska, and Carcross, Yukon Territory, Canada. The old hard-working truck with wooden side panels likely hauled countless loads of stuff in the Klondike area of Yukon in the post-gold-rush years. Today it's retired and looks a bit stuck in the mud.
One can't feel too sorry for this truck, though, considering all the attention it gets from travelers and the incredible beauty surrounding it. Visit my Yukon images, and you'll see what I mean. To me this is a picture of a life well-lived. Several artistic filters were used in the processing of this original photograph to augment its crusty look.
